		<description>Some minor clarification:

The Sunday AM service is part of the schedule for BASIC TRAINING troops, not the army in general.  Basic trainees have a very restricted and compact schedule with little to no flexibility.   All other army troops may attend worship services of their choice at whatever time and place they choose.  Basic training lasts for only 11 to 14 weeks after which  a new cadre of troops arrives.  Approximately 1,000 troops per year rotate through the Jewish Program.

If not for Jewish Federation of Columbus, a relatively tiny community, it would be impossible to sustain this worthwhile and impacting program.
